in the USAMount Saint Joseph University is a very small not-for-profit
Catholic college offering many disciplines along with the sociology & anthropology major and located in
Cincinnati,
Ohio. The school was founded in 1920 and is presently offering bachelor's degrees in Sociology.
Mount Saint Joseph University is very expensive: depending on the program, tuition is about $37,000 per year. If you are seeking a cheaper alternative, check
Affordable Colleges in Ohio listing.
It is reported that Mount Saint Joseph University area is relatively unsafe - the school is reported to have
a rather poor rating for campus security.
